Filofax Essentials Review #1 - Pens.

Welcome everyone!

Here is another series called Filofax Essentials. My main objective will to review essentials that many people use for their Filofax. If you would for me to review a certain product, you can email me @ liveloveorganize21@gmail.com

:)

Today's topic is the essential item - the must have item for your Filofax! What could it be? Pens, of course! There will be other pen reviews but for right I thought I start off with some pens everyone has heard off but might not have seen how they work.

1. The Coleto!



The Pilot Hi-Tec-C Coleto is available in 3, 4, or 5 barrels. The pen in the above photograph is a 5 barrel pen. It is a quite think pen - It will most likely on fit into a elasticized pen loop, but it is worth it! 
It is a multi-pen. You can hold both pens and pencils in it and customize it to the way you like it - just like a Filofax! 


For this 5 barrel pen, I chose 5 pen colors. They are clear blue, black, apple green, pink, and purple. This pen is great if you love to color code since they don't bleed through and write very smoothly. Here is an example of how they write - 

As you can see, it's very smooth and very neat. For my handwriting, it felt really comfortable since I tend to write a lot everywhere. 

And here are the specific colors I choose, 

The main body componenents for the pens range from $4-8 dollars depending on the size you would like, and most pen refills go for about $2 dollars. You can find this pen and many more at jetpens.com! Or you can click here and automatically be directed toward them :) 

2. The FriXion Slim! 



 The FriXon Ball Slim is a perfect pen for elasticized and non-elasticized pen loops! It fits both perfectly! They are retractable and erasable! Here is an example of how they write! :)


They are very smooth and write very finely. They are the perfect small size and will definitely be comfortable for anyone who writes a lot or a little! :) 

Here is how the erasable pen works. As you can see you can see my writing, but that's probably where I press down to much. Other than that, the pen's eraser works smoothly and everything comes off just nicely since other erasable pens usually leave some of the pen mark behind. 

You can find both of these pens at JetPens, and if you spend $25 dollars or more - you get free shipping. No code needed!

Filofax Organization #2 - Setting up your Filofax

Welcome to Post #2 in the series, Filofax Organization

Today's topic is - Setting up your Filofax

In the last post, we talked about choosing a Filofax. You can click on the link here if you haven't seen it :)

Setting up your Filofax is the most important thing to do right after you purchase your Filofax. You want to create it your own dividers and make it your own!

Here are the steps!

1. Choose a diary layout! Find what you like, Find out how much you do per day - Ask yourself these questions:
  - How much do I do per day?
  - Do I write a lot and/or write big? Do I want a lot of page space?
  - Do I want to diary inserts to be thick or thin? (meaning a lot of pages)
  - Do I want a weekly insert and/or a monthly insert?

These questions are very important - because you don't want to choose a diary layout that you don't like and then spend the whole year with a set up you can't enjoy.

Credit: Filofax

There are several diary inserts - Day Per Page, Day on Two Pages, Week per page, Week on Two pages.. They also come in cottom cream (which is a thicker type of paper and much softer) <-- Cotton Cream is definitely a recommendation if you write a lot or like to color code, and they also come in just the plain white. 
Credit: pensandleather
They also have a monthly on two pages (above) if you love to see everything at a month on a glance. They also carry it a month on one page. 

You can find all the diary inserts that Filofax carries here and depending on the size of your Filofax, your inserts may vary. 

2. Set up your Dividers or create your own! 

Creating your own dividers can seem hard - but it's actually really easy. You can find some inspiration here and you can also check on Philofaxy or Youtube on how to create your own dividers. 

Setting up the dividers that Filofax sends with your organizer is easy too! Here are some ideas of what tabs you can create..
 - Calender
 - Finance
 - Information
 - Blog/Youtube
 - Addresses
 - Passwords (keep them encrypted though!)

You can create dividers for just about anything - the same way you can create a Filofax for just about anything! :) 

3. Grab some essentials! 
Credit: JetPens

Pens are of course, a must! You can use different type of pens to color code and highlight whatever you want in your Filofax.
Credit: Filofax

Grab some pretty notepaper for your writing notes or for anything you need to jot down! The Filofax paper is my favorite since it's colorful and you can fit a lot of information! 

You can find all the organizer essentials that Filofax carries here. They carry organizer stickers, and notepaper, hole punches, and even extra flyleaf's/pockets.
